Known by those who respect and depend upon it as "The Great Mother," and by those who revile and fear it as "The Great Tyrant," Cresce ['kreɪsh] stands on par with Alderode as one of the most powerful countries in Kasslyne. Westernmost on the continent, Cresce enjoys a stable, educated society that places supreme emphasis on social equality. It is the first and only country in Kasslyne with a "moneyless" economy, exercising rigid state control and social pressure to declare Greed as great a crime as murder or rape.

Government

Cresce's political system involves a matrilineal monarchy held by a succession of Queens, and a cabinet of advisers, guild masters, and ambassadors. Below the monarchy, an expansive but rigidly controlled web of state offices control Cresce's seventeen districts, producing and distributing resources among its population, assigning employment, managing housing, and settling disputes.

The current queen of Cresce is Manaraishala Sonorie, whose family has ruled Cresce for approximately 400 years. With a cultural emphasis on the Mother Goddess of the Gefendur religion, and a history that began one-thousand years earlier when the country was won in battle by the warrior-queen Crescia, it's perhaps no surprise that Cresce's is a largely matriarchal culture.

Features

Cresce's climate is temperate, verging on tropical further south. It is a rich and fertile, well-organised country with a powerful military, engineer corps, and merchant marine.

Cresce founded the West Kasslynian Alliance, a group of countries that stands allied and united against invasion and other outside military threats. To protect this alliance, Cresce's allies are frequently patrolled by the Peaceguard, who are charged with maintaining national borders against criminals and enemies of the state, providing humanitarian assistance, as well as promoting cooperation with other nations.

Cresce has a long history of strife with its northern neighbour, Alderode. The two countries hold diametrically opposed views on each others' politics, culture, values, religious practises, geography, and history, and frequently go to war with one another. While Alderode is viewed primarily as an unreasonable aggressor, Cresce is seen in a more tolerant light by most denizens of Kasslyne.
